Best School Administration colleges in San Francisco

Best School Administration colleges in San Francisco for 2026

Saint Mary's College of California offers 5 School Administration degree programs. It's a small, private not-for-profit, four-year university in a large suburb. In 2024, 26 School Administration students graduated with students earning 13 Certificates, 7 Doctoral degrees, and 6 Master's degrees.

California State University-East Bay offers 2 School Administration degree programs. It's a large, public, four-year university in a large suburb. In 2024, 37 School Administration students graduated with students earning 26 Master's degrees, and 11 Doctoral degrees.

University of San Francisco offers 4 School Administration degree programs. It's a medium sized, private not-for-profit, four-year university in a large city. In 2024, 30 School Administration students graduated with students earning 17 Master's degrees, and 13 Doctoral degrees.

San Francisco State University offers 4 School Administration degree programs. It's a very large, public, four-year university in a large city. In 2024, 45 School Administration students graduated with students earning 38 Master's degrees, and 7 Doctoral degrees.

Northeastern University Oakland offers 1 School Administration degree programs. It's a very small, private not-for-profit, four-year university in a large city.

Notre Dame de Namur University offers 1 School Administration degree programs. It's a very small, private not-for-profit, four-year university in a large suburb. In 2024, 2 School Administration students graduated with students earning 2 Master's degrees.

University of California-Berkeley offers 2 School Administration degree programs. It's a very large, public, four-year university in a midsize city. In 2024, 15 School Administration students graduated with students earning 15 Master's degrees.
